Denmark entry requirements for Kenya passport holders
Kenya passport holders need a visa to enter Denmark. You must apply for a Schengen visa before you travel — there is no visa-on-arrival or e-visa option. This page covers everything you need to know for 2026.
Entry requirements
| Requirement | Details | Status |
|---|---|---|
| Valid passport Must be valid for entire stay | Your Kenyan passport needs at least 2 blank pages for entry stamps. Denmark follows Schengen rules — your passport must be valid for your entire stay, not necessarily 6 months beyond. Airlines may still enforce 6 months validity, so check with your carrier before flying. | Required |
| Return or onward ticket Proof of departure from Schengen | Immigration officers at Copenhagen Airport routinely ask for a return or onward ticket showing you leave the Schengen area within 90 days. A bus or train ticket to a non-Schengen country works too. Have a printed or digital copy ready. | Required |
| Proof of accommodation Hotel booking or invitation letter | Carry a confirmed hotel reservation for every night of your stay, or a signed invitation letter from a host in Denmark. The letter must include the host's CPR number and address. Immigration may ask to see it at the border. | Recommended |
| Proof of funds Show you can support yourself | Have bank statements or a credit card showing access to at least €45 per day of your stay. Cash, traveler's cheques, or a sponsor letter also work. Officers rarely ask, but if they do, you need to show the funds immediately. | Recommended |

Transiting through Denmark
Kenya passport holders need a transit visa to change flights in Denmark, even if staying airside.
- Holders of a valid Schengen visa or residence permit may transit without a visa.
- Holders of a valid visa for the UK, US, Canada, Japan, or Australia may transit without a visa under certain conditions.
